Intestinal Carriage and Excretion of Campyiobacter jejuni in Chickens Exposed at Different Ages

Campyiobacter jejuni is usually recovered from chickens in commercial broiler farms after 2 to 3 weeks of age. This study was conducted to clarify whether fecal excretion is associated with the age of exposure to this bacterium. Day-of-hatch broiler chickens were separated from a flock in a local commercial farm, kept in isolation rooms, and esophageally inoculated with C. jejuni (5.5 × 10~7 to 5.4 × 10~8 CFU) at 0, 7, 14, 21, 28, and 35 days of age. The remaining chicks were placed on the farm. Fecal samples obtained from the birds with the experimental infection and those reared on the farm were monitored for C. jejuni. Cecal contents obtained on necropsy were also cultured. In chickens inoculated with C. jejuni at 0 to 14 days of age, fecal excretion of C. jejuni was not observed until 42 days of age, although the organism was recovered from the cecal contents of these birds. When chickens were inoculated at 21 to 35 days of age, C. jejuni was isolated from fecal samples 2 or 3 days after inoculation, and the birds continually shed the organism until they reached 49 days of age, with the maximal numbers of the organism ranging from 1.7 × 10~8 to 1.0 × 10~(10) CFU/g. In the commercial broiler farm, C. jejuni was first isolated from fecal samples obtained from two of five chickens at 28 days of age, and the organism was isolated from all five birds tested at 43 days of age. Restriction fragment length polymorphism analysis of the fla gene of C. jejuni isolates revealed that birds on the farm were colonized with C. jejuni after placement of the chickens on the farm. These observations indicate that chickens younger than 2 to 3 weeks old may carry C. jejuni in the ceca if they were exposed to this organism. Our results also suggest that fecal excretion of C. jejuni in commercial broiler chickens older than 3 to 4 weeks of age may be mainly caused by exposure of chickens at this age to this organism.
